Fight

On August 7th around 11:55 p.m., police were dispatched to 35 Omaha Street for a report of a fight. On arrival police observed a male get into a passenger vehicle and begin driving across the parking lot. An employee of the business ran out to inform the officer that this individual was involved in the fight. Police stopped the vehicle near one of the exits of the parking lot. The driver, identified as 31-year-old Randal Martell of Rapid City, immediately exited the vehicle. He was detained in handcuffs and the officer noted the strong smell of an alcoholic beverage coming from his person. After speaking to witnesses, police determined the incident began as a disturbance between Martell and a group of individuals inside the store. As the parties exited the store, it began to get physical with Martell identified as the predominate aggressor. Following a DUI investigation, Martell was placed under arrest for three counts of Simple Assault and DUI (4th). During a pre-tow inventory of the vehicle, police located marijuana and associated paraphernalia, along with a loaded pistol located in the driver’s door panel. Martell was booked into the Pennington County Jail with the additional offences of Possession of a Loaded Firearm while Intoxicated, Possession of Marijuana, and Possession of Drug Paraphernalia.
